    On the other hand, UI change... lol. Is it possible you haven't heard about the Lua support ingame? :) You can modify the UI as much as you want, set it up exactly how you like it. (Though I like the basic UI so dont have first-hand experience with Lua)

     

    Edit: wasn't sure since when so just checked the dev diaries, the manager went live with Isengard: http://lorebook.lotro.com/wiki/Update_5,_Armies_of_Isengard,_Official#Lua_Plugin_Manager
